Many daily direct flights connect Singapore and Bangkok in about 2h20 on full-service and low-cost carriers — one of the region's busiest, cheapest air routes. Bangkok's main gateway is Suvarnabhumi (BKK); some routes also use Don Muang (DMK) — see our getting-around guide for the airport run.
Your nationality currently gets Thailand's 60-day visa exemption, with an approved cut to 30 days pending publication in the Royal Gazette — verify the current limit before you travel. For anything longer you'll want a long-stay visa (retirement, DTV, LTR) — see our visa comparison.
Bangkok is a global city but still far cheaper than most Western home countries — a comfortable single lives on ฿50,000–80,000/month and a couple on ฿70,000–110,000, excluding international-school fees. The resident Singaporean base is smaller, but Bangkok sees heavy business and weekender traffic from Singapore and is a common regional base for people working across Southeast Asia. Find your area in the neighbourhoods guide.
Time zone: Singapore is UTC+8, so Bangkok is 1 hour behind.
